Grace's Story
Grace is a 2-3yo mixed-breed girl currently weighing around 70 pounds. She originally came into one of our local shelters as a very pregnant stray, and raised her litter of pups in a foster home. They've all found homes, and now it's her turn!<br/><br/>Grace is deaf, and would strongly benefit from an adoptive home with an established, well-socialized canine friend, and she will require a fenced yard. Her current bff is a French bulldog in her foster home. She is housebroken, crates well, but will need some continued work on basic manners and leash work. Grace has also had eyelid surgery to correct bilateral entropian. She can be timid in new situations - we doubt she was ever socialized well outside of the home, and prospective adopters will need to understand that she will likely be a bit wary and stand-offish at first. Once she's comfortable, she's a ton of fun, and will thrive with someone who wants to continue working with her on hand signals. <br/><br/>Grace is spayed, microchipped, and current on vaccines. She is being fostered in Bay City, MI, and her adoption fee is $100.
